What’s currently running on mine:
- 10 commodity SSDs through a powered USB hub forming a poor man’s NAS with snapraid + mergerfs
- Podsync for converting my favorite YouTube channels to podcast feeds
- Syncthing for generic file synchronization
- K3s for whatever projects coming to my mind
- Retroarch for occasional gaming needs
- MPD with a floppy disk interface as my music station
- CUPS for printserver

4·4 months agoPlanetComputers Gemini is a pretty close modern day replica made by the same engineers who put their experience into creating the Psion 5.
Quite pricey for a somewhat limited by today’s standards smartphone if you ask me, but still available on Ebay.
https://www.ebay.de/itm/336168116080 for example.
And yes, it can run Ubuntu.
